Is Management Scale of a Cluster Related to the Number of Master Nodes?
Management scale indicates the maximum number of nodes that can be managed by a cluster. If you select 50 nodes, the cluster can manage a maximum of 50 nodes.
The number of master nodes varies according to the cluster specification, but is not affected by the management scale.
After the multi-master node mode is enabled, three master nodes will be created. If a master node is faulty, the cluster can still be available without affecting service functions.
